There wasn&#8217;t much of Belgium left before I crossed in to the Netherlands &#8211; and then just a few kilometers until the German border. It only took 30 minutes before I was at the German border.<\/p>\n<p>I refilled with petrol while still in the Netherlands: Today being Sunday, just about every petrol station apart from those in motorway service stations was closed. This did mean I probably paid more than I should have done, but no problem.<\/p>\n<p>I didn&#8217;t realise it at the time, but the petrol station was right on the Dutch\/German border (I&#8217;d not seen the decimal point in the sign which said how many km to the border, and thought it said 10). So almost immediately after pulling out of the services, I was on the German Autobahn.<\/p>\n<p>It took a while before it finally clicked that I was on the Autobahn, in an unrestricted section. What on earth was I doing trundling along at 120km\/h &#8211; the speed limit of the Dutch A76!? I put my foot down and slowly increased the speed.<\/p>\n<p>After passing a set of roadworks and then returning to a bit of de-restricted Autobahn, I found that with no HGVs on the roads (I do love Sundays)\u00a0the traffic was light enough that I was able to get up to 145km\/h (90mph) in the slow lane. There was the odd caravan &#8211; all but one of them British &#8211; but they weren&#8217;t a problem.<\/p>\n<p>In fact at one point I was in lane 1 keeping pace with the car in front, with an indicated speed of 97mph on my dashboard. I&#8217;d lose my license in the UK but in this country it&#8217;s relatively slow: I was being overtaken by Audis and BMWs all the time &#8211; they go like bullets!<\/p>\n<p>So 90mph became my cruising speed &#8211; jumping up to 160km\/h (100mph) in lanes 2 and 3 but for no more than a few miles at a time. The top speed I reached &#8211; according to my sat nav &#8211; was 170km\/h which works out as 106mph. I could probably have gone faster if I had the inclination &#8211; but I stuck at a speed I was comfortable with.<\/p>\n<p>It wasn&#8217;t all high speed driving; There were many sections with speed limits, particularly around big junctions and through roadworks. The journey was uneventful and I felt very &#8220;at home&#8221; on the Autobahn! Despite what you might think, the German Autobahn isn&#8217;t aggressive: It&#8217;s just fast &#8211; and surprisingly enjoyable.<\/p>\n<p>I&#8217;m don&#8217;t think it will be like that all week though: There will be HGVs to contend with, along with rush hour traffic. Germany&#8217;s roads get very busy, very quickly.<\/p>\n<p>As I moved through Germany the scenery changed quite considerably.
